Barnes & Noble Booksellers, Warren County Public Library, and WKU Libraries host the Southern Kentucky Book Fest, one of the state’s major literary events. The Book Fest, which takes place every year, attracts thousands of readers of all ages who are excited to meet their favorite writers and acquire autographed copies of their works.
The annual SOKY Book Fest will take place on March 26th from 9 a.m. to 3 p.m., and has been named one of the Kentucky Travel Industry Association’s Top 10 Festivals & Events for numerous years. The popularity of the event, its influence on the local tourism industry, as well as cultural and historical relevance, are all factors in the selection process. In 2022, the Bowling Green International Festival will be held in person for the 32nd time!
Every year on the last Saturday in September, Bowling Green’s lovely Circus Square Park transforms into an International Paradise, with people from all over the world gathering to proudly celebrate their many cultures. Music, dancing, demonstrations, genuine delicacies, edutainment activities, cultural exhibits, and an international mart are all part of the festival, which respects our inhabitants’ background and variety. A wide range of music and dance is performed on stages and in performance venues. Throughout the festival, there are activities, contests, and events.Â

The Holley LS Fest, one of BG’s flagship automotive events, is a celebration of anything and everything powered by the legendary GM LS engine! In a variety of events, LS-powered racing vehicles, street rods, muscle cars, trucks, and late models will compete. Drag racing, autocross, the 3S challenge, show-n-shine, Track X, drifting, and more events are included. Holley’s hometown track, the historic Beech Bend Raceway, and the NCM Motorsports Park just up the road will host events September 9-11.
